North Central Railway

North Central Railway, with its headquarters at Allahabad, is popular for its passenger friendly services.

North Central Railway, AllahabadNorth Central Railway, Allahabad came to be recognised as a separate entity from 1st April 2003. This was done to meet the growing demand for transportation facilities for this zone. The North Central Railways serve a large area of North India with its divisions at Allahabad (headquarters), Jhansi and Agra. The trains plying at North Central Railway connect states, such as, Madhya Pradesh, Haryana, Uttar Pradesh and Rajasthan.

The North Central Railway (NCR) is renowned for its tourist friendly services. Places, such as, Agra, Chitrakut Dham, Khajuraho, Gwalior and other tourist destinations can be accessed with the help of the trains running to and fro for North Central Railway, Allahabad. For a mother operation this division of Indian railway has been categorised into several departments, like, administrations, medical, mechanical, operation, civil engineering, construction, safety, security, electrical, commercial, etc.

For the convenience of both national and foreign passengers there are online services where one can check out the train services, their timings, cancellation rules and others. Trains, like, Chennai Express, Gour Express, Mumbai Mail, Amritsar Express, Poorva Express, Deheradun Express and numerous other trains are part of the North Central Railway (NCR), Allahabad services.
